AS Arselia reminisces in the time where she seemed so free and so loved, she feels a pang of sadness in her chest. Not of her own, but of her soul bond's. The sadness continues to build up and she can feel every ounce of Loki's emotions fill her being. She breathes heavily while sitting on her bed, and feels tears prick her eyes. Concerned about Loki's well being and where abouts, the goddess decides to leave her quarters and search the palace for where her pained brother could be. 

The raven haired goddess makes her way through the palace locating Loki's Seidr. The energy from his magic was located within his quarters, so the warrior headed that way. When she made it to his doors, she went to open them, but they were sealed with magic. "Loki, please open up." Arselia says with worry evident in her tone. "Go away, Arselia." She can here the sadness in his words and can tell he's been crying with how hoarse his voice sounds. "Please don't shut me out, talk to me." In that moment the god needed comfort, he needed someone by his side, he needed her. He let down the magic seal with enough time for Arselia to come in. When she walked through his living quarters, she made it to his main bedroom where he stood looking at himself in front of a mirror. 

She walked up behind him and put her hand on his shoulder. Even with him knowing she was there and seeing her in the reflection, he still managed to flinch at the contact. Arselia furrowed her eyebrows. "Talk to me." She says softly. "I'm afraid if I do, you'll turn against me." She made Loki turn to face her and put her hands on either side of his face. She gently wiped the tears the kept on falling from his eyes and kissed his forehead. "I would never turn against you." The god takes Arselia's hands off his face as his skin slowly turns blue. The goddess lets out a small gasp as her eyes widen. The gears in the blue and green eyed goddess's mind are practically shifting. Loki looks at her pained, a similar look to the one he gave her when the Jotun touched him and his skin simply turned blue instead of burning. "You're a Jotun." She whispers. The frost giant looks down in shame and turns back to face the mirror. "Now you see me, sister. The monster I am. I won't judge you for turning against me, if that's what you please." Arselia shook her head in disbelief. "B-but your Odin's son, you're Frigga's son." 

The god's jaw clenches along with his fists. His red eyes seem to turn ever redder at the mere mention of his supposed father. "No, not Odin's son. Laufey's son. Odin took me from Jotunheim as a child. A stolen relic that would be used to make peace between the two realms." The mischievous goddess's eyes widen even more and mutters under her breath "Laufey's son." "Yes, Laufey's son. The son of a monster. Look at me, dear soul bond, do you see a monster?" A tear roles down Arselia's cheek and she puts a protective shield over her hands so that she can grab Loki's face without getting burnt. Loki once again flinches at the contact and goes to move away, but then sees the protective magic on his soul bond's hand. "You, Loki, could never be a monster. Misunderstood, yes. But a monster? Never." 

The god slowly transforms back into his Asgardian form and latches onto his other half. He nuzzles his face into her shoulder and she can here the sniffles coming from him. The two sink to the ground with the broken god practically holding on for dear life to the warrior goddess. The one person he feels as if he can trust. The one person he feels that he has left. Not even his mother, who was most likely in on the secret could make him feel comfortable like his soul bond does. While the god cries, Arselia soothes his back and runs her hand though his hair to comfort him. Laufey's son. Not just the son of any frost giant, but the leader of them. Maybe that's why Odin always put Thor first and left Loki in the shadows, because he wasn't truly his son. The lies that the trickster pair should've been able to sniff out, went over their heads for many millennia. The constant need to impress others and look for their validation not only resigned within Loki from his "father" disregarding him, but it also resigned in Arselia. 

The validation from others is what she strived for whether she would like to admit it or not. That's why she does the things that she does. She never got to know her parents before they died as she wished to, so she looked to Odin and Frigga as her parental figures. Never wanting to disappoint them, she did as they said, especially Odin. Becoming a warrior and princess of Asgard was his idea and she decided to go along with it. Though it was a gruesome journey of training, she never once quit, and became the outstanding warrior she is today. So, when she heard Loki had a plan for Thor to be put aside and have Loki become the King of Asgard, she was immediately in for it. No matter what, Loki would always see Arselia as valid in his eyes, but Arselia never knew that. She wanted to please and make sure that Loki was happy, so she went along with his mischievous plan. Although, a small part of herself truely did want the crown, and wanted to be able to rule the people as their queen. To do what she feels is right in the kingdom. To have Loki by her side as they rule in harmony. To have the one man that made her feel so free and so loved watch her be crowned queen. 

But of course, those are only dreams. Wants. We can all so desperately want something and yet still not get it. Will she ever see the man the she loves ever again? Probably not. But is there a chance for her to become queen and rule her kingdom beautifully? Yes, yes there is. So if there is one thing that seems so clear in the goddess's mind that can happen, one thing that she can get her hands on and grasp, one thing that she can actually have, she'll take it. Because that one thing seems to be the only thing Arselia has going for her. The one thing that she feels as if she doesn't need much validation from, but will still ask for anyways, because a queen must be confident and independent, yet still take requests and listen to the people. Her people. But right now, she must be there for Loki. Her brother, no matter what. Her soul bond.

A few hours went by as the pair sat in Loki's quarters leaning into each other for comfort. Arselia learned that when Loki found out the truth about his bloodline, Odin became so weak that he went into Odin Sleep. As the raven haired god began to get up from where him and his soul bond were sitting, The blue and green eyed goddess attempted to bring him back down. "Where are you going?" "I must go to fath...Odin's quarters where he resides for Odin Sleep. Hopefully the queen can give me answers I seek for." The goddess seemed to be saddened by the way that her brother addressed his former parents. Though Odin was not good in hindsight, she still at times saw the way he cared for Loki and loved him. Frigga on the other hand was a wonderful mother. Always present in her childrens' lives, and always made sure to give Loki the attention that he craved. The raven haired goddess watched as her other half stood up, but also extended a hand for her. 

Loki looked at her with the eyes a Midgardian would say resembled those of a puppy. "Join me, I do not wish to embark on this alone." The god said pleadingly. Without a second thought the warrior goddess takes his hand and he brings her up onto her feet. The pair brush off whatever dust that might have gotten on their clothes off, and link arms. The mischievous god and goddess proceed to make their way out of Loki's quarters on to the King and Queen's. While walking Arselia could see the pained expression on Loki's face. Watching closely she saw as his jaw clenches ever so slightly and how his brows furrow. The god was so deep in thought, that he didn't even notice the goddess examining him. She knew he was in pain, she could feel it. She felt the disbelief and the betrayal. She knew he would attempt to keep it together in front of Frigga, but on the inside his walls that he built up as he became older, were shattering. She knew that those walls that kept him from letting too many people in were coming down because of the people that he decided to let in. The people who he believed to trust, who he believed would never lie to him. For the god of lies, he was upset with himself because he couldn't point out the biggest lie that was ever told to him. 

After a few moments of walking throughout the golden palace, the two made it to the large quarters for the rulers of the kingdom. The two guards standing in front of the doors gave access to the prince and princess, and opened the door for them to walk in. The pair make their way to the usual room in which the All Father would reside, whenever falling into Odin Sleep. When the golden doors opened to the sleeping chamber, the soul bonds' eyes were immediately drawn to the bronze bed that Odin layer on. A protective magical barrier surrounded the bed, but also gave off a golden luminescence to the room. The All-mother was shown sitting next to her husband's bed with a look of concern etched upon her face, though she immediately looked up when she saw her son and daughter walk into the room. Arselia examined the king's state. He looked almost angelic sleeping peacefully in the large bed, dressed in white, covered in a fur blanket. His skin glowing from the magical barrier, and eye patch shining.

The goddess followed Loki as he sat at the opposite end of the bed from where Frigga sat. The goddess of thunder quietly sat down next to Loki, and took in the scene in front of her. Though Loki despises Odin for the secret that he kept from him, she knew he hated seeing the white-haired god like this. Fragile, weak, unable to protect himself. As a child, the goddess can remember the days when Loki would stand guard with the guards at the door to Odin's chambers while the king was in Odin Sleep, to ensure that no one would dare to hurt his father while in that state. A small smile forms on her face from the memory, but immediately falls when she sees a tear run down her queen's cheek. 

The queen immediately wipes it away, and looks to her son, then back to her husband. "I asked him to be honest with you from the beginning. There should be no secrets in a family." Frigga says softly. The queen's eyes flicker over to Arselia momentarily, before going back to her son. The warrior princess felt as if something was wrong with that statement, she had a gut feeling that something wasn't completely right. Deciding against asking anything, she remained quiet and allowed the mother and son pair to have their talk. "So why did he lie?" The mischievous god asks. "He kept the truth from you so that you would never feel different." In that moment, Arselia took Loki's hand. She knew better than anyone else that Loki always felt different. He would use magic rather than pure strength to make his way through a battle. The Warriors Three, Lady Sif, and Thor would constantly tease him for that when he was younger. They made sure that he knew he was different, that he knew he wasn't one of them.

"You are our son, Loki. And we your family, you must know that." Frigga says softly with a slight crack in her voice. The raven haired goddess can feel the conflict building up within her other half. The want to love his family and go back to before he found out who he truly was, but also the want to yell and scream and lash out because of what they kept from him. "You can speak to him, the both of you. He can see and hear us, even now." The queen states, finally addressing the fact that Arselia was also in the room with them. "How long will it last?" The god asks. "I don't know, this time it's different. We were unprepared." "I'll never get used to seeing him like this. The most powerful being in the nine realms, lying helpless, until his body is restored." Loki says. "He seems to be so peaceful, yet he suffers quietly and in pain." Arselia says softly. 

Her soul bond knew in that moment that not only was she talking about Odin, but about himself. She knew of the internal war he had within himself, she knew of his struggles, she knew that if she wasn't there to talk it out with him, he would explode from anger and sadness. "He's put it off for so long now, that I fear." The blonde queen says while gently grabbing her husband's limp hand. "You're a good son, and you a good daughter. We mustn't lose hope that your father will return to us. And your brother." A wave of uneasiness washes over Arselia at the mention of her blonde brother. Loki's hand squeezes hers lightly as he also tenses up. "What hope is there for Thor?" "There's always a purpose to everything your father does for me, yet find a way home." The god of mischief looks to the All-Mother for a moment before getting up. Arselia follows right behind him, still hand in hand as they were before. 

Just as the two went to walk out of the room, the doors to the chamber open. Five royal guards are shown getting down on their knees, just as two high ranking royal advisers, one carrying Odin's staff and the other carrying a green velvety pillow with a golden crown placed upon it, walk into the room. The two men make their way closer to the pair, and they let go of each other's hands. The royal advisors bow down to the prince and princess, presenting Gungir to Loki, and the Queen's crown to Arselia. The goddess's eyebrows furrow in confusion and she tilts her head slightly to the side. The raven haired god and goddess turn to look towards their queen for answers. "Thor is banished, the line of succession falls to you until Odin awakens. I wish to stay by my husband's side until he is recovered, therefore the crown falls upon you as well, my child. Though I don't wear it much, I know you will. You will wear it with pride, dear girl. Asgard is yours." Frigga states. The warrior princess takes a breath as she turns around to have her eyes meet with the beautiful crown.

The detailing on the crown is shown magnificently even though there isn't much light in the room. A golden design of leaves and feathers is show at the base, while in the middle there are four emeralds, three darker colored, than the one in the middle. The sound of Odin's crows echo throughout the room as the royal advisors present the staff and crown even more to the shocked pair. Hesitantly, Arselia reaches to pick up the crown, just as Loki reaches for Gungir. The two turn around once more to see their queen with a proud smirk on her face. Loki clutches onto Gungir tighter as Arselia slowly places the crow atop her head. "Make your father proud, my king and my queen." Frigga says. 

Loki's lips slowly form into his infamous smirk, just as Arselia smiles, but it doesn't quite reach her eyes. It's almost as if the weight of the nine realms have been poured onto her soldiers, and she can't help be feel nervous, though she would never admit it. Her soul bond turns to her with his smirk still plastered upon his face. She can't help but smile herself as she sees how happy he is, and how her brother finally has a chance to prove that he is a worthy king. Worthy. Just as it did before, her smile drops, but not all the way. Thor is still stranded on Midgard without his powers or his hammer. She once again feels uneasy and even sad that Thor didn't even get to see this wonderful moment for his brother, but also because he's alone. The goddess knew what it felt like to feel all alone, and scared. She just hopes Thor will get the help he needs from the people on Midgard, and soon gains his worthiness back so that he can return to the safety of his home.
